A week or so ago, kd announced to the world (or my part of it at least) that trackback was here. She expounded upon its virtues and generally doted upon it. As many of you realize, I don’t use MT. I code everything I use with TLC, PHP, and MySQL. I knew I had to implement Trackback, because it was too great of a feature NOT to use.

So I dug in and found out that the implementation really isn’t as scary as one might think. It’s a very simple, yet very powerful feature. What I’ve realized, though, is that trackback won’t REALLY catch on (outside of the MT world) until someone comes up with a remotely hosted trackback facility.

What would this new facility have to do?
1. Keep track of pings for your entries.
2. Display a count of those entries and allow pop-up or inline trackbacking. (trackingback?)
3. Allow a for customizable interface.
4. Allow for exporting to XML… just in case you ever decide to port to MT, and Ben and Mena add support for importing trackback.
5. A little bit of security to block pings from undesirable folks.
6. ALLOW YOU TO PING OTHERS.

After a bit of thought and a bit of coding, I’ve decided that this solution would not be terribly complicated to do, and I think I’d have fun doing it.
